The California Report: Many college buildings still vulnerable to quakes

Over the past thirty years, the University of California and the Cal State system have spent well over a billion dollars shoring up seismically unsafe buildings. But the two systems still have nearly 180 buildings judged to be at risk in a major earthquake.
